Wolfenbüttel: Christian IV. von Dänemark und Graf Philipp Reinhard von Solms

Contact Cite this page Data sheet (PDF) Canonical version (record) Calculate distance to your current location Mark for comparison Graph view

Description

Vorderseite: Bekrönte Initiale Christians IV. aus dem Buchstaben C und der Ziffer 4.
Rückseite: Wappenschild der Grafen von Solms.

Inscription

Vorderseite: QVID NON PRO RELIGIONE Ao 1627
Rückseite: MONET R D N VIC PHIL REINH C S

Material/Technique

Silber; geprägt

Measurements

Diameter
44 mm
Weight
28.49 g
